Fireglow Japanese MapleAcer palmatum 'Fireglow' Height: Typically 6–8 feet tallSpread: Approximately 6–8 feet wideSpacing: Plant 6–8 feet apart for a balanced, multi-stem displayGrowth Rate: Slow DescriptionFireglow Japanese Maple bursts onto your landscape with a dazzling display of fiery, scarlet foliage that emerges in early spring and deepens to a rich, glowing crimson as the season progresses. Unlike traditional tree forms, its naturally spreading, multi-stemmed habit creates a stunning, bush-like silhouette that adds a vibrant splash of color and refined texture to any outdoor setting. This captivating specimen serves as an ideal focal point in shaded borders or as an eye-catching accent in containers, offering a timeless, elegant statement that draws admiring glances all season long.
